Cologne, Aachener Weiher

Downtown Cologne is almost completely encircled by a park belt which is in the place of the former inner city fortification. It is seven kilometers long and on average 200 meters wide. The strictly geometrical artificial pond is called "Aachener Weiher". Due to the proximity of the university, the adjacent lawns are especially popular with students. There's also the "Beer Garden at the Aachener Weiher." Since 2004, the part of the park belt between Aachener Street and Bachemer Street is called Hiroshima Nagasaki Park. The name goes back to an initiative by the Cologne Peace Forum.
